CT manifestations and diagnosis of bronchial tuberculosis with mucus impaction

Abstract: Objective  The CT manifestations and features of endobrochial tuberculosis (EBTB) complicated by mucous plug impact (MPI) were analyzed in order to improve the levels of imaging diagnosis.   Methods  CT features and morphological characteristics of 25 cases of EBTB complicated by MPI who were confirmed the diagnosis by fiberoptic bronchoscopy was analyzed.   Results  There were typical CT features in EBTB complicated by MPI: (1)Direct signs: 10 cases (40.0%) of crotch-like shadow, 8 cases (32.0%) of squeezing toothpaste-like shadow, 7 cases (28.0%) of glove-like shadow. (2) Distribution and morphology of lesions:  irregular lumpy shadows distributed in interior 2/3 lung fields in each lobe, lesions are expansive, with sharp edges, and concentrically distributed. (3)Characteristic of accompanied signs: around the main lesions, 23 (92.0%) cases surrounded by multiple punctate and small pieces of satellite lesions, 13 (52.0%) patients had chronic formation process, like concentrated lung-markings in focals, reduced lung volume, and emphysema. 6 cases (24.0%) with CT examination showed the left or right main bronchus stenosis. (4)Characteristic of enhanced CT: CT valuation of mass focals of 12 patients was less than 20HU for enhanced CT. After the regular anti-TB treatment, all 25 patients had good therapeutic effect.   Conclusion  EBTB complicated by MPI could display crotch, squeezingtoothpaste or glovelike signs. Mastering the CT manifestations and features is conducive to improve the imaging diagnosis levels of EBTB complicated by MPI.
